The MIDLAND METAL 707001-0404 is a lead-free brass male adapter designed to transition between a 1/4 inch male iron pipe thread (MIPT) connection and a barbed insert fitting. This fitting is used to join threaded pipe or tubing ends to flexible insert-style hose or tubing in low-pressure fluid systems. The lead-free brass construction meets drinking water safety requirements, making it suitable for potable water applications. Plumbers and pipefitters install this adapter where a threaded port must connect to insert-barb tubing without soldering or specialized tooling.
This adapter is suited for residential and light commercial plumbing applications, including potable water supply lines, irrigation connections, and hydronic distribution systems where a transition from threaded fittings to flexible tubing is required. The 1/4 inch MIPT thread engages standard pipe threads on valves, manifolds, or equipment ports, while the insert end accepts compatible barbed tubing. Licensed plumbers and pipefitters typically install this fitting during new construction, retrofit, or repair work.

Installation should be performed by a licensed plumber in accordance with applicable local plumbing codes and IPC guidelines. Shut off the water supply and relieve system pressure before installing or removing any fitting. Apply thread sealant tape or compound to the MIPT threads before assembly and hand-tighten before using a wrench to avoid over-torquing the fitting body. Ensure the insert barb end is fully seated into compatible tubing and secured with an appropriate clamp or crimp ring per the tubing manufacturer's instructions.
